From Aimé Césaire’s 1969 seminal Caribbean reworking of The Tempest, Une Tempête (1969), charged with the markedly homosocial politics of “Negritude”, to more recent Bollywood film adaptations of Romeo and Juliet, animated by campy song and dance routines, postcolonial authors have long engaged with gender crossing and non-normative sexuality as modes to critique the so-called colonial “Bard”. Staff supervise research in the following areas: African literature in English and in translation, Caribbean literature, African-American and Native American literatures, Australian literature, New Zealand and South Pacific literature since 1800, Indian and South-East Asian literature in English and in translation, middle-eastern literature and mediterranean literature, postcolonial women writers, theory, and travel writing.
